Part 2: Technical Specifications and Functionality – The 3ds Max Perspective

The use of *3ds Max* signifies a professional-grade approach to the modeling process. This powerful software allows for the creation of highly detailed and realistic 3D environments. Specific technical aspects of *Restaurant Room 3ds Max File 195* are expected to include:

* Polycount: The *polygon count* will be a key indicator of the level of detail. A higher polycount allows for greater realism but may impact rendering times. The balance between detail and performance will be crucial.

* UV Mapping: Proper *UV mapping* ensures that textures are applied correctly and efficiently. This is essential for preventing distortions and achieving a high-quality render.

* Materials and Shader Assignment: The *materials and shaders* used will significantly influence the final look and feel. The use of physically based rendering (PBR) techniques will likely be employed to ensure realistic lighting and material interactions.

* Rigging and Animation (Potential): While not guaranteed, the file may include *rigging* and *animation* elements, particularly if it's designed for specific applications like virtual reality (VR) or augmented reality (AR) experiences. These would add a dynamic element to the otherwise static scene.

* File Organization: A well-organized *file structure* is crucial for efficient workflow. This includes properly named objects, materials, and layers, making it easy to navigate and modify the model.
